SUPPLEMENTARY REPORTS
Stewards opened an inquiry into the reason trainer D Brennan (BLANKET SHOW) was presented to race at the Cairns Race meeting on Saturday the 8th December 2007 without obtaining a Veterinarian Certificate as directed by Stewards at the Cairns Meeting on the 26th October 2007. After hearing evidence Stewards charged trainer D Brennan with a breach of ARR 175(p) and was subsequently fined $100.
Stewards opened an inquiry into the reason trainer G Duncan (MOTORMOUTH) failed to scratch from the Cairns meeting on the 8th December 2007. Stewards charged trainer G Duncan with a breach of ARR 114 (c) and was subsequently fined $150
RACE 1: ROOSTERS FOOTBALL CLUB MAIDEN PLATE 1100M
1st: Brer Fox 2nd: Korolev 3rd: Razydance 4th: Cat Ballou
STYLISH EFFECT (P Edwards) was a late scratching by order of the Stewards at 12.30pm when the filly pulled away from barrier staff on two occasions and refused to load. Stewards ordered all bets on STYLISH EFFECT to be refunded and deductions were made 7cents and 8cents ($13). Connections were advised the filly must obtain a further barrier certificate prior to its next start.

.RACE 2: BARRON VALEY HOTEL CLASS B HANDICAP - 1400M.
1st: Robin The Hood 2nd: Top D’World 3rd: Admiral Rogers 4th: Bozo Lad
Jockey K Rockett (ROBIN THE HOOD) was granted permission to ride 2.5kgs overweight when no other suitable rider was available.
Jockey T Weeks (AITCH TO OH) was granted permission to ride 2kgs overweight as no other suitable rider was available. All outlets were notified immediately.
TOP D’ WORLD (D Crossland) was unruly on the way to the start causing a minor delay. Connections were advised a warning was placed on the gelding for its behaviour.
BOLD BARASSI (P Edwards) was slow away.
TOP D’WORLD was then held up for clear running rounding the home turn.
MALS BOY (G Clegg) raced greenly in the straight.
Jockey C Eaton (DOWN THE BARREL) was cautioned when her mount shifted out abruptly near the 300m hampering MALS BOY.
